Secure Your Environment: Anti-Ligature TV Systems
In medical settings, ensuring patient safety is paramount. This includes protecting against potential harm from objects that could be used as ligatures, such as cords and straps attached to televisions. Anti-ligature TV protection systems are designed to mitigate these risks by firmly mounting TVs to walls or stands, making it difficult for them to be removed. These systems often involve reinforced fixtures that prevent tampering and ensure the TV remains firmly in place. By implementing these protective measures, you can create a more secure environment for patients and staff alike.
- Additionally, anti-ligature TV systems often incorporate features that limit access to potentially dangerous cords and cables. This can include features such as enclosed wiring, cable covers, or flush-mounted connections.

Minimizing Ligature Risks in Healthcare Environments: Anti-Ligature TV Mounts
In healthcare facilities, patient safety is paramount. One often overlooked risk is the potential for ligature incidents, where patients might use objects to block blood flow or cause injury. Traditional TV mounts present a particular challenge in this regard, as their sturdy construction and accessible components frequently turn into potential ligature points. To mitigate these risks, anti-ligature TV mounts have emerged as a vital safety solution.
These specialized mounts are designed with features that remove the possibility of ligature use. They typically feature concealed mounting hardware, sturdy brackets, and tamper-resistant configurations. By discouraging the proximity of potential ligature points, anti-ligature TV mounts create a safer environment for patients and staff alike.
- Additionally, these mounts are often fabricated from durable materials that resist tampering and damage. This added strength and durability ensure that the mount continues to be a secure fixture, even in challenging environments.
